Castile and León (Spain) - Phosphorus Fertilisers Use

Since 2014, Castile and León (Spain) Phosphorus Fertilisers Use was down by 49.1% year on year. With 1,600 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 115 among other countries in Phosphorus Fertilisers Use. Castile and León (Spain) is overtaken by Franche-Comté (France), which was number 114 with 1,736 Metric Tons and is followed by Limousin (NUTS 2013) at 1,567 Metric Tons. Turkey ranked the highest with 291,373 Metric Tons in 2019, +28.1% compared to 2018. Spain, France and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Community of Madrid (Spain) witnessed the best average annual growth at +79.3% per year, while Castile and León (Spain) was the worst growing country at -49.1% per year.
